Several weeks ago (beginning to middle of June) I changed the Internet
Explorer home page to http://www.alpharetta.ga.us/ on both my PC and laptop
and have not been able to change home page to anything else. All other pages
come up correctly when entered. When I go to another page and click on the
link to make it my home page, it goes to that page but if I click on home,
it reverts back to http://www.alpharetta.ga.us/. When on the page I want, I
have gone into tools, internet options, general and clicked use current,
apply and ok. But when I click on home, it again reverts to
http://www.alpharetta.ga.us/.

I have Windows XP Pro SP2 and Internet Explorer 6 and am current on updates.
I have disconnected Zone Alarm and Spy Sweeper separately and at the same
time and tried again and the same thing happens. Could one of the Microsoft
updates in June changed something so my home page can not be changed?
Anti-virus, firewall or both anti-spyware softwares that I use have not
found anything that might point to the problem.

Exhausted and run out of ideas on how to correct. Any suggestions/help would
be most appreciated.

Hi Judith,
This a cut and paste from a user had the same problem as your's please read
and apply:
First of all do you run these softwares on your computer:
= Zone Alarm = Spybot S&D in Tea Timer Mode = Spy Shierf = WeatherBug
= AdAware =spysweeper.... etc.
If yes, then proceed, Open the RUN command and type : msconfig click oK
On the Window click on the Start Up Programs Tab and uncheck the
pre-mentioned programs from starting up.
Then Reboot and see if you could change your Homepage.
If no joy then do the following:

Change the Home page in the following KEYS:
Click on *Main*
[+]H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Main.

and look in Right Pane/Window and Locate *Start Page* Right
Click on it and select Modify and enter the Data say for ex;
http://www.MyWeb.com as your Home page and then Locate also this *Local
Page* and Right Click on it and select Modify and put the following;
C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M\blank.htm

The same with this KEY:
[+] H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Main
On the *Start Page* change it into http://www.myweb.com

Leave the *Local Page* as it is if it have this stringe of Data:
http://www.microsoft.com/isapi/redir.dll?prd={SUB_PRD}...... etc

Close the Registry and Open the IE Properties by Right Click on the Icon on
your Desktop and select Properties from the drop down list.
On the IE window click on Programs Tab and click on Manage Add-Ons, in the
Add-Ons window Disable Add-Ons for Non-MS IE Add-Ons (ZA, Safer network..etc)
and click OK.
On the same window click *Reset web Settings* and click Apply/OK and Reboot
your computer and see if the new home page is set.

If you still can't change the homepage then you need to uninstall the
Culprit software which blocking you from changing the Address like (ZA, S&D,
AD-Aware...etc), and remove their left behind traces on the System by using
the Local Search engine on the start button and also in the Registry, but be
carefull in the registry not to delete a system file if you in doubt leave it.
After finishing Restart your Machine and see if the issue cured, if all Okay
reinstall your software and configure them to protect your Machine and let
you have control on your computer.
